After hitting 40 and deciding to become a MAMIL (middle aged man in lycra) for my health, I've challenged myself to do one of the most respected cycling events in South Canterbury!

I'm currently training to complete the Central South Island Charity Bike Ride, a +385km circuit from Timaru - Tekapo - Kurow - Timaru over three days. The ride begins on Feb 22nd with the last day Feb 24th.

The ride raises funds Hospice South Canterbury, The Y South & Mid Canterbury, Life Education Trust Mid & South Canterbury, Presbyterian Support South Canterbury – Family Works, Multiple Sclerosis South Canterbury, Mokihi Hauora, Timaru Riding for the Disabled and L4U(Learning for You)
